Overview

EV2610ER-00A from Monolithic Power Systems is an evaluation board for the MP2610 switching Li-Ion battery charger IC, supporting 1- or 2-cell configurations with up to 2A programmable charge current, 1.1MHz fixed-frequency operation, ±0.75% battery voltage regulation accuracy, and integrated thermal/battery temperature protection - used for rapid validation of high-efficiency charging in portable power systems.

Technical Context

The EV2610ER-00A implements the MP2610 IC in a fully assembled, tested layout with QFN16 footprint, supporting 5.5–24V input and delivering regulated 4.2V (1-cell) or 8.4V (2-cell) output. It uses two independent control loops for precise constant-current (CC) and constant-voltage (CV) charging phases.

Board-level features include on-board 4.7µH power inductor (Cooper DR73-4R7-R), 100mΩ precision current-sense resistor (Vishay WSL2512), NTC thermistor interface, and dual-color LED status indicators driven from VREF33 - all configured per MP2610 Rev. 1.1 reference design guidelines.

Key Specifications

Parameter Value and Actual Design Meaning
Form Factor Evaluation board (2.5" × 2.5" × 0.5") with pre-routed MP2610 QFN16 layout and test points
Supported IC MP2610 - monolithic synchronous buck charger with integrated 28V/3.5A MOSFETs
Charge Current Range Programmable up to 2A via external sense resistor (RS1 = 100mΩ default)
Input Voltage Range 5.5V to 24V DC - validated for 19V adapter input per Quick Start Guide
Battery Output Options 4.2V (1-cell) or 8.4V (2-cell) selectable via Cell pin connection to VREF33
Switching Frequency Fixed 1.1MHz - enables compact magnetics and low EMI without external compensation
Protection Features Thermal shutdown, battery overtemperature (NTC), charge timeout, and full-battery termination

Manufacturer

Monolithic Power Systems (MPS) is a fabless semiconductor company specializing in high-performance analog and power ICs, with core expertise in DC/DC conversion, battery management, and motor control solutions.

The MP2610 product line delivers highly integrated switching Li-Ion chargers targeting space-constrained, thermally sensitive applications such as smartphones, netbooks, and distributed power systems where efficiency, accuracy, and reliability are critical.

FAQ

What is the default battery voltage setting on the EV2610ER-00A?

The board is preset to 4.2V output for single-cell Li-Ion operation. To configure for two-cell (8.4V) charging, the Cell pin must be connected to VREF33 per the Quick Start Guide - no resistor changes or firmware updates are required.

How is charge current programmed on this evaluation board?

Charge current is set by the 100mΩ sense resistor RS1. Using the formula ICHG = 200mV / RS1, the default value yields 2A. Replacing RS1 with a different resistance (e.g., 200mΩ for 1A) recalibrates full-scale current without circuit modification.

Does the board support battery temperature monitoring?

Yes - it includes a 10kΩ NTC thermistor (Yageo RC0603FR-0710KL) connected to the MP2610's TS pin, enabling battery temperature sensing and automatic charge suspension if thresholds are exceeded, per MP2610's built-in thermal protection logic.

What do the green and red LEDs indicate during operation?

LED1 (green) illuminates when valid input voltage is present and within operating range. LED2 (red) lights during active charging and turns off upon battery full termination, fault condition, or no battery connection - providing immediate visual state feedback without external instrumentation.

Can the EV2610ER-00A be used with non-Li-Ion chemistries?

No - the MP2610 IC and board design are optimized exclusively for Li-Ion/Li-Polymer battery profiles, including CC/CV regulation, 4.2V/8.4V termination voltages, and NTC-based temperature limits aligned to lithium chemistry safety requirements.

Is the MP2610 IC soldered to the board or socketed?

The MP2610 is permanently mounted in QFN16 package (U1) using standard reflow soldering - not socketed. The board is intended for functional evaluation and reference design replication, not IC replacement or swapping.
